Indoors or out Plants can help make your home stand out. If you'd like your interior style to be noticed, beautify your interior with big plants. Install a few large plants in the hallway or in the living room. They're also affordable and can be a good option to enhance your decor without breaking the budget.
Here's my tip to get it right: paint a wall only 3 quarters or half height from top to bottom. Ceilings will appear taller creating the illusion of bigger. In addition, you'll save by using less paint. By following this method, consider exploring deeper and more intense colors as well as an lighter shade on the ceiling as it will make the room feel airy and bright. Boo! People are increasingly turning to organic minimalism, and are embracing wooden panels to create that elevated appearance. A recent client of mine was a renter who wasn't able to paint and even was allowed to make wood-paneling the wall, it would have been way over budget. However, I used an innovative trick! I came across a peel and stick wallpaper with the pattern of a wood panel on it. The transformation was amazing when I placed this on the bed of my client. It instantly brought the look of warmth, texture, and elevated look to the room. Vertical lines make the ceilings appear to be twice as high. Click here to view my IG Reel. The peel-and-stick wallpaper took just three hours to put on and costs about 200 dollars. If you decide to move or desire an entirely different appearance, simply take off the wallpaper. It is crucial to follow the manufacturer's instructions and check the wall prior to installing the wallpaper.

If you're not sure, try adding some black This is my favorite. I always do it! You can add a black item to your decor, be it an item like a vase, candle or the pot. Even a black chair. Recently I added a dark coffee table to my living room because I never liked the lighter hue. It always felt like it was floating. Black grounded the space instantly.
Repeat - If the lamp is amazing, why not add one more (place them on either side)? It can balance the look of a sideboard, particularly in the event that it's very long and you aren't sure what else to add.
In order to find the perfect balance within a room, it does take time to rearrange and swap and then re-arrange. But don't get sucked into the symmetry of your placement, or it could appear over-styled.
The days of rigid rules regarding paint are no more, the main thing to do for interior design today is to adopt the idea of paint that works for you. Interior designers are no longer painting door frames, ceilings and skirting boards in stunning white. Painting the skirting the same identical colour as the walls will help to make a room appear larger.

Japanese interiors are filled with calm and tranquility. They are not averse to 'noisy design'. The Japanese interiors are defined by a muted color palette as well as wooden furniture, as well as lots of natural sunlight. The importance of order and organization also plays a part in Japanese homes as they tend to steer clear of too much ornamentation in favour of clutter-free spaces.
